Monel Coils are coils made from Monel, a group of nickel-copper alloys known for their excellent corrosion resistance and high temperatures. These coils provide exceptional strength and durability, making them ideal for complex applications in marine engineering, chemical processing, aerospace and other industries. Monel coils are valued if capable of withstanding harsh environmental conditions and maintaining their integrity over extended periods of use, making them a popular choice for critical operations where reliability is paramount.

Mechanical Properties of Monel Coils

Element Density Melting Point Tensile Strength Yield Strength (0.2%Offset) Elongation
Monel 400 8.8 g/cm3 1350 °C (2460 °F) Psi – 80,000 , MPa – 550 Psi – 35,000 , MPa – 240 40 %

Monel Coils Chemical Composition

GradeCuFeNiCMnSiS
Monel 40028.00 – 34.002.50 max63.00 min0.30 max2.00 max0.50 max0.024 max
